Kochi: Malayalam actor and director Sreenivasan, who underwent a bypass surgery at a private hospital in Angamaly, is on the path to recovery. 

He was hospitalised on March 30 after he complained of chest pain. An Angiogram test revealed that he is suffering from triple vessel disease — an extreme form of coronary artery disease (CAD). Subsequently, he underwent a bypass surgery on March 31. He is in the intensive care unit of the hospital.

"Sreenivasan's health condition is improving and he is responding to treatment. His health is stable," the hospital said in the medical bulletin.
